AI-generated summary
Peter Simpson, a 68-year-old man serving a prison sentence, died from terminal mantle cell lymphoma at Long Bay Hospital in September 2018. He had been diagnosed with lymphoma in 2015 and received chemotherapy and surgical interventions through 2017, with clear disease progression noted. By late 2017, his prognosis became poor and he signed an advance care directive refusing CPR. He was transferred to the Medical Sub-Acute Unit in August 2018 and reviewed by palliative care team in late August and early September. He died naturally from his terminal malignancy while receiving appropriate palliative care. His family raised no concerns about the medical care provided during custody. The death was investigated as mandatory under coronial law due to custody status, but no clinical errors or inadequate care were identified.
